Basic Information

Product Name 7-Nitro-1-Tetralone
CAS No. 40353-34-2
Molecular Formula C₁₀H₉NO₃
Molecular Weight 191.18 g/mol
Synonyms 7-Nitro-3,4-dihydronaphthalen-1(2H)-one; 1-Tetralone, 7-nitro-; 7-Nitro-α-tetralone; 7-Nitro-3,4-dihydro-1(2H)-naphthalenone; 7-Nitrotetralone; 7-Nitro-1-oxotetralin; 7-Nitro-3,4-dihydro-2H-naphthalen-1-one

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from heat, sparks, and open flame. Due to its light-sensitive nature, containers should be kept in secondary opaque packaging or amber glass.
